The Standards team is looking for an editor to help safeguard our journalistic independence, credibility and excellence. Standards team members advise colleagues on issues such as fairness, sourcing, language, framing and display type. We also respond to queries about ethics concerns, like relationships with sources or reporting practices. We work with every newsroom desk and across every form of our journalism, and our team is a crucial voice in discussions of all the new ways that we want to work. We are partners with many other teams, including communications, audience and newsroom development and support, in ensuring that our journalism is created and defended according to a shared understanding of our commitment to accuracy and fairness. The Test Editor drafts test items and conducts editorial reviews and item development for various medical examinations and assessments to ensure their quality, integrity, and accuracy. This role involves editing, revising, and finalizing complex written and graphic medical examination material. The Test Editor also collaborates with staff and guides physician volunteers/subject matter experts (SMEs) through all aspects of item development.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ES The essential functions include, but are not limited to, the following: Reviews and edits medical examination material, ensuring accuracy, clarity, and adherence to appropriate guidelines and style guides for high-stakes physician specialty certification. Provides quality control review of items, cases, and item writer evaluation materials, including higher-level content editing such as appropriateness for exam pool and clarity of testing points. Maintains quality standards through finalizing examination material via rigorous editing, peer review, and application/publication review of complex written and graphic content. Provides authors and SMEs with feedback, including higher-level content editing such as appropriateness for the item pool and clarity of testing points.
